KFin Technologies Share Price: A Financial Analysis
The financial infrastructure landscape is experiencing a period of heightened activity, particularly within Depositories, Clearing Houses and Other Intermediaries. This segment is crucial for the seamless functioning of capital markets, and KFin Technologies is a significant player. Our analysis examines the current standing of the KFin Technologies share price, which currently sits at ₹967.70. This analysis forms part of a comprehensive, 80-parameter fundamental audit, diligently verified by Sweta Mishra, ensuring a robust and insightful assessment.
A primary metric to consider is the Price-to-Earnings (PE) ratio. KFin Technologies' PE of 54.63 suggests the stock is trading at a relatively high valuation compared to its earnings. In contrast, assessing the management quality of peers like
N S D L is essential. Their operational efficiencies and strategic decision-making directly influence their respective valuations and market positions.One of KFin Technologies' strengths lies in its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) of 32.75%. This indicates the company is efficiently generating profits from its capital investments. A consistently high ROCE, like this, contributes significantly to building a sustainable economic moat. This competitive advantage allows KFin Technologies to command pricing power and retain market share, especially relative to players like Computer Age Management Services Ltd and Central Depository Services India Ltd.
Ultimately, the interplay between KFin Technologies share price, its valuation metrics, and its operational efficiency determines its long-term investment potential. Further investigation, including a detailed examination of financial statements and industry trends, is required for a comprehensive understanding.

About KFINTECH (KFin Technologies Ltd)
KFin Technologies Ltd (KFINTECH) is listed on the National Stock Exchange (NSE) and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E) of India. The company operates in the Depositories, Clearing Houses and Other Intermediaries sector with a current market capitalisation of ₹18.89K (Cr). KFin Technologies Ltd has delivered a Return on Equity (ROE) of 24.97% and a ROCE of 32.75%. The debt-to-equity ratio stands at 0.03, reflecting the company's capital structure. Investors tracking KFINTECH share price can monitor key metrics including P/E ratio, promoter holding of 22.89%, and quarterly earnings growth.
